AMD announces new industrial ethernet chipsets... amd.com "AMD ANNOUNCES AVAILABILITY OF FAST ETHERNET CHIPSET FOR INDUSTRIAL TEMPERATURE APPLICATIONS --AMD shipping 10/100 Physical layer and controller devices capable of -40°C to +85°C operation-- SUNNYVALE, CA --DECEMBER 15, 1999--AMD today announced the immediate availability of two 10/100 Mbps Ethernet devices that provide full functionality in environments in the -40°C to +85°C industrial temperature range. The AMD NetPHY™-1LP physical layer (PHY) and the PCnet-FAST™+ controller devices provide design engineers reliable and cost-effective choices for reducing their systems' environmental limitations. The two devices can be used together or separately, depending on specific application requirements. Only the NetPHY-1LP PHY is needed in applications that already have an Ethernet media access controller available, such as designs using custom ASICs. Only the PCnet-FAST+ controller is needed in applications that use the controller's MII or GPSI interface, such as backplane communication within a chassis-based system. Together, these devices offer a complete Fast Ethernet solution capable of sustained operation under extreme temperature conditions. AMD's Family of Ethernet Devices A leading networking component supplier since 1984 with more than 250 million network ports shipped in the past five years, AMD has offered industrial temperature Ethernet devices for many years. AMD's 10 Mbps industrial temperature Ethernet products include: Am79C940 MACE single-chip16-bit 10 Mbps Ethernet controller Am79C961A PCnet-ISA II single-chip ISA bus 10 Mbps Ethernet controller Am79C970A PCnet-PCI II single-chip PCI bus 10 Mbps Ethernet controller. These devices are now joined by the Am79C972 PCnet-FAST+, a 32-bit PCI bus 10/100 Mbps Ethernet controller, and the Am79C874 NetPHY-1LP, a 10/100 Mbps TX/FX Ethernet PHY. Both devices offer the following key features: IEEE 802.3 compliant, with support for full Auto-Negotiation operation 3.3 volt with 5 volt tolerant I/O Advanced Power Management modes The PCnet-FAST+ controller implements an IEEE 802.3-compliant Ethernet Media Access Controller (MAC) with full Auto-Negotiation of 10 or 100 Mbps, half- or full-duplex operation, and a Media Independent Interface (MII) for connection to any standard 10/100 Mbps physical layer (PHY) device. The PCnet-FAST+ controller integrates a high-performance 32-bit PCI bus master interface, large SRAM memory buffers and advanced power management including AMD's patented Magic Packet™ remote wake-up technology. The PCnet-FAST+ controller is offered with a broad range of network software drivers supporting all leading operating systems including Windows, NetWare, Linux and VxWorks. It is also widely supported by third-party embedded software providers including WindRiver, ISI, QNX, Lynx and Pacific Softworks. The NetPHY-1LP device is capable of supporting 10BASE-T, 100BASE-TX, and 100BASE-FX operation. The MAC interface supports the MII, 5B Symbol, and 7-wire (GPSI) standards. The physical media dependent layer supports CAT-3 twisted-pair for 10Mbps and CAT-5 twisted-pair for 10/100Mbps operation, as well as PECL for 100BASE-FX fiber optic transceivers. Four PowerWise™ management modes are available to reduce power consumption below the normal one-third Watt. Diverse Applications Need Industrial Temperature An increasing number of applications require industrial temperature operation, including enclosures with restricted airflow and equipment exposed to extreme temperature conditions. For voice and data communication applications, where devices are placed in environments with extreme temperature conditions, reliability is essential. Package and Availability The Am79C874 NetPHY-1LP device is available direct through AMD and authorized AMD distributors in an 80-pin TQFP package. The Am79C972 PCnet-FAST+ device is available direct through AMD and authorized AMD distributors in a 160-pin PQFP or 176-pin TQFP package. The Am79C874 NetPHY-1LP device is priced at $ 3.95 in 10K-unit quantities direct through AMD. The Am79C972 PCnet-FAST+ device is priced at $ 9.75 in 10K-unit quantities direct through AMD
